
API接口参数的修改方法包括:通过API文档了解参数结构、在代码中修改参数值、使用API测试工具进行验证、确保修改后的参数符合接口规范。本文将重点探讨通过API文档了解参数结构这一点,因为了解参数结构是修改API接口参数的基础。
API接口参数是与服务端进行通信的重要部分,正确的参数结构和内容才能保证请求的成功和数据的准确性。通过API文档了解参数结构,不仅能够确保修改的参数符合接口规范,还能够提高开发效率,减少错误。
一、API文档的重要性
1、文档的作用
API文档是开发者与API进行交互的指南,详细记录了API的各项功能、请求方法、参数结构、返回数据格式等信息。通过API文档,开发者可以清晰地了解每个接口的具体用法,避免因参数错误而导致的请求失败。
2、文档的内容
API文档通常包括以下内容:
- 请求URL:接口的访问路径。
- 请求方法:如GET、POST、PUT、DELETE等。
- 请求参数:包括必填参数和可选参数,参数名、类型、默认值等信息。
- 返回数据:接口返回的数据结构、字段说明等。
了解这些内容,开发者才能有效地修改API接口参数,确保与服务端的交互正确无误。
二、在代码中修改参数值
1、确定参数位置
在代码中找到需要修改的API请求部分,通常是通过HTTP请求库(如axios、fetch等)进行的。在请求配置对象中,找到参数的位置,一般在请求体(body)、查询参数(query params)或路径参数(path params)中。
2、修改参数值
根据API文档的说明,调整参数的值或结构。例如,如果API要求传递一个JSON对象,确保对象的字段和类型与文档一致。修改完成后,保存代码并进行测试。
3、编码规范
在修改参数时,遵循编码规范非常重要。清晰的代码结构和注释可以提升代码的可读性和维护性,减少后续修改和调试的难度。
三、使用API测试工具进行验证
1、选择合适的工具
市场上有许多API测试工具,如Postman、Swagger、Insomnia等。选择一个适合团队和项目需求的工具,可以有效地进行API测试和验证。
2、构造请求
在API测试工具中,构造一个与代码中相同的请求。填写请求URL、方法、参数等信息。通过工具发送请求,观察返回结果,验证参数修改是否正确。
3、调试和修改
如果请求失败或返回结果不正确,通过工具的调试功能分析问题所在。可能是参数值有误、缺少必填参数、参数类型不匹配等。根据错误提示和API文档,逐步调整参数,直到请求成功。
四、确保修改后的参数符合接口规范
1、类型检查
确保参数的类型与API文档中的要求一致。例如,整数类型不能传递字符串,布尔类型不能传递数字。严格的类型检查可以避免数据错误。
2、必填参数
确保所有必填参数都已传递,缺少必填参数会导致请求失败。根据API文档,检查每个接口的必填参数列表,确保没有遗漏。
3、参数值范围
有些参数有特定的取值范围或格式要求,例如日期格式、枚举类型等。确保参数值在允许的范围内,格式正确。
五、常见问题及解决方法
1、参数格式错误
API请求失败时,首先检查参数格式是否正确。例如,JSON对象是否闭合、数组元素是否用逗号分隔等。使用格式化工具或在线验证工具检查参数格式。
2、权限问题
有些API接口需要特定的权限或认证信息。检查请求头部是否包含正确的认证信息(如Token、API Key等),确保权限问题不会影响请求。
3、网络问题
网络连接问题也会导致API请求失败。检查网络连接状态,确保能够正常访问API服务器。使用Ping或Traceroute工具检查网络连通性。
六、项目团队管理中的API接口参数修改
在项目团队管理中,API接口参数的修改需要团队协作,确保每个成员了解修改内容和目的。推荐使用以下两个系统:
1、研发项目管理系统PingCode
PingCode专注于研发项目管理,提供详细的项目计划、任务分配、进度跟踪等功能。通过PingCode,团队成员可以清晰地了解API接口参数修改的任务分配和进展情况,提高协作效率。
2、通用项目协作软件Worktile
Worktile提供全面的项目协作功能,包括任务管理、文件共享、沟通交流等。在API接口参数修改过程中,团队成员可以通过Worktile进行讨论、共享文档、记录修改历史,确保信息同步和透明。
七、总结
修改API接口参数是开发过程中常见的任务,通过API文档了解参数结构、在代码中修改参数值、使用API测试工具进行验证、确保修改后的参数符合接口规范,可以有效地完成这一任务。项目团队管理系统PingCode和Worktile则为团队协作提供了有力支持。通过这些方法和工具,开发者可以高效地修改API接口参数,保证项目的顺利进行。
相关问答FAQs:
1. 我想修改API接口的参数,应该如何操作?
要修改API接口的参数,您需要首先查找API文档或联系API提供者,以了解哪些参数可以被修改。然后,您可以通过修改请求的URL或请求体中的参数来进行修改。确保您使用正确的参数名称和数值,并按照API文档中的要求进行正确的格式化。
2. 修改API接口参数会对系统的运行产生什么影响?
修改API接口参数可能会对系统的运行产生不同的影响。具体影响取决于参数的含义和作用。例如,修改某个查询参数可能会导致返回的数据集发生变化,而修改某个身份验证参数可能会影响您对API的访问权限。因此,在修改参数之前,请确保您了解参数的含义和对系统的影响。
3. 如何避免在修改API接口参数时产生错误?
要避免在修改API接口参数时产生错误,您可以采取以下措施:
- 仔细阅读API文档,确保您了解每个参数的含义和用法。
- 在修改参数之前,先进行备份或测试,以确保您可以还原或回滚到原始状态。
- 使用适当的工具或编程语言来发送API请求,并确保正确设置参数名称和数值。
- 如果可能的话,尽量在开发环境中进行修改和测试,以减少对生产系统的影响。
- 如果您不确定如何修改参数或担心产生错误,请咨询API提供者或开发团队的支持。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2702754